1. A device for isolating a carbon dioxide indicator from the atmosphere, comprising:
- an annular shaft having an internal wall and an external wall, the shaft having a fluid passage formed through at least a portion of its length, the fluid passage operable to place the internal wall in fluid communication with the external wall, the internal wall defining a longitudinal axial aperture;
a filter barrier removably disposed about the external wall and operable to separate the indicator from the external wall;
first sealing means coupled to the external wall;
second sealing means coupled to the external wall and spaced apart from the first sealing means, the fluid passage and the filter barrier located between the first sealing means and the second sealing means, the second sealing means separated from the first sealing means by a distance greater than the height of the indicator;
a carbon dioxide absorber removably disposed within the aperture; and
a plug operable to removably occlude the aperture to isolate the indicator from the atmosphere.

Abstract
A resuscitator is provided with an integral carbon dioxide detector for indicating the presence of carbon dioxide in a patient. The carbon dioxide detector is a conventional pH sensitive chromogenic compound that is positioned in the breathing circuit to permit a rapid indication. Additionally, a unique plug is provided for sealing the indicator from the atmosphere while in storage to prevent contamination and degredation of the indicator compound.
